First off, let's talk about what pin type forks are. These are forks that are attached to the forklift using pins. It's a pretty straightforward setup, but it has some major implications for how the forklift operates. One of the biggest advantages of pin type forks is their simplicity. Unlike some other attachment methods, there aren't a whole bunch of complicated mechanisms or parts to deal with. You just slide the forks onto the mast and secure them with the pins, and you're good to go.

This simplicity translates into easier installation and removal. If you need to switch between different types of forks or other attachments, pin type forks make the process a breeze. You don't have to spend a lot of time fiddling with bolts or other fasteners. This means less downtime for your forklift, which is a huge plus in a busy warehouse or industrial setting.

Now, let's get into how pin type forks affect the forklift's turning radius. The turning radius is basically the amount of space a forklift needs to make a turn. With pin type forks, the design allows for a more compact attachment to the forklift. This means that the overall length of the forklift with the forks attached is often shorter compared to other types of forks. As a result, the forklift can make tighter turns, which is really useful in narrow aisles or confined spaces.

Imagine you're working in a warehouse with narrow racks. You need to be able to navigate between the racks quickly and efficiently. A forklift with pin type forks can make those sharp turns without having to back up and reposition as much. This not only saves time but also reduces the risk of collisions with the racks or other equipment.

Another aspect of maneuverability that's affected by pin type forks is the forklift's stability. When the forks are properly attached using pins, they provide a secure connection to the forklift. This helps to distribute the weight of the load evenly across the forklift. A stable forklift is easier to control, especially when you're carrying heavy or unevenly balanced loads.

For example, if you're lifting a pallet of heavy boxes, a forklift with pin type forks will be less likely to tip over or sway from side to side. This gives the operator more confidence and allows them to move the load more safely. It also means that you can carry larger loads without having to worry as much about the forklift's stability.

Pin type forks also offer some flexibility in terms of load placement. Since they can be easily adjusted and positioned on the mast, you can place the load exactly where you need it. This is important for optimizing the forklift's center of gravity and ensuring that the load is balanced. A well-balanced load makes the forklift easier to maneuver, as it reduces the strain on the steering and other control systems.

Let's say you're moving a long, awkwardly shaped item. You can adjust the pin type forks to accommodate the shape of the load and position it in a way that keeps the forklift stable. This makes it possible to handle a wider variety of loads with greater ease.

In addition to the maneuverability benefits, pin type forks are also durable and long - lasting. They're designed to withstand the rigors of daily use in a tough industrial environment. The pins are made of high - quality materials that resist wear and tear, ensuring that the forks stay securely attached to the forklift over time.

However, it's important to note that proper maintenance is still crucial. You need to regularly check the pins and the attachment points for any signs of damage or wear. If the pins are loose or damaged, it can affect the forklift's maneuverability and safety. So, make sure to follow the manufacturer's maintenance guidelines.

When it comes to choosing the right pin type forks for your forklift, there are a few things to consider. First, you need to make sure that the forks are the right size and capacity for your forklift. You don't want to overload the forks or use forks that are too small for the loads you'll be carrying. Second, look for forks that are made from high - quality materials. This will ensure that they last longer and perform better.
